1. Install "qca-qt5-pkcs11.x86_64" package
Please follow the step by step instructions below to install qca-qt5-pkcs11.x86_64 on Fedora 35
$
sudo dnf update
Copied
$
sudo dnf install
qca-qt5-pkcs11.x86_64
Copied

3. Information about the qca-qt5-pkcs11.x86_64 package on Fedora 35
Last metadata expiration check: 5:29:49 ago on Wed Sep 7 02:25:42 2022.
Available Packages
Name : qca-qt5-pkcs11
Version : 2.3.3
Release : 1.fc35
Architecture : x86_64
Size : 64 k
Source : qca-2.3.3-1.fc35.src.rpm
Repository : fedora
Summary : Pkcs11 plugin for the Qt5 Cryptographic Architecture
URL : https://userbase.kde.org/QCA
License : LGPLv2+
Description : Pkcs11 plugin for the Qt5 Cryptographic Architecture.
